Facile Synthesis of Modified MnO2/Reduced Graphene Oxide Nanocomposites and their Application in Supercapacitors

Abstract

Herein, KH-550 was used as surface modifier to prepare modified MnO 2 /reduced graphene oxide (M-MnO 2 /rGO) composite electrode materials by utilizing electrostatic interaction at low temperature and normal pressure. X-ray diffraction, scanning electron microscopy, transmission electron microscopy and X-ray photoelectron spectroscopy were adopted to characterize the material’s phase, morphology, and valence state of elements. The electrochemical properties of the material were measured using a three-electrode system. The results indicate a decrease in the size of the modified MnO 2 particles, and that they were uniformly distributed on the rGO sheets. The M-MnO 2 /rGO composite attained a specific capacitance of 326[Formula: see text]F[Formula: see text]g[Formula: see text] in a solution of 1[Formula: see text]mol[Formula: see text]L[Formula: see text] Na 2 SO 4 at a current density of 0.5[Formula: see text]A[Formula: see text]g[Formula: see text]. The specific capacitance of the material was 92.4% after 1000 cycles. The electrostatic self-assembly method effectively solved the problem of reducing the cycling stability while improving the specific capacitance of the composite materials, and further improved the possibility of applying MnO 2 /rGO in the field of supercapacitors.
